Overview

Henkjan Honing is affiliated with the University of Amsterdam in the Netherlands. Their research primarily focuses on the intersection of neuroscience and music perception, with substantial work extending into animal vocal communication and behavior.

The main fields of study for this researcher include Neuroscience and Biochemistry, Genetics and Molecular Biology. Within these areas, they have contributed extensively to subfields such as Cognitive Neuroscience, Developmental Biology, Ecology, Evolution, Behavior and Systematics, Experimental and Cognitive Psychology, and Social Psychology.

The key topics covered in their work are:

  • Neuroscience and Music Perception
  • Animal Vocal Communication and Behavior
  • Hearing Loss and Rehabilitation
  • Neural Dynamics and Brain Function
  • Animal Behavior and Reproduction
  • Multisensory Perception and Integration
  • Avian Ecology and Behavior
